OVERVIEW: The NT‑37C is a heavyweight anti-submarine torpedo derived from the U.S. Navy’s Mk 37 series, redesigned in 1975 for extended range and speed. It uses a liquid monopropellant engine, passive/active acoustic homing, and offers wire-guided mid-course updates.

DETAILS: “NT” denotes Northrop Torpedo upgrade; “37” references the Mk 37 lineage; “C” marks the first full conversion from electric battery to Otto Fuel II propulsion. It measures approximately 3.43 m in length, 533 mm diameter, and weighs about 650 kg, carrying a 150 kg HBX‑3 warhead. Speed increased by over 40% and range by ~150%, achieving ~36 kn and ~15 km range, compared to the original’s 26 kn and 9 km. Its guidance includes initial gyroscopic run, wire mid-course control, and passive/active terminal homing using improved acoustic transducers . Entered service circa 1973–1975, it retained operational relevance into the 1990s with allied navies using it into the early 2000s .

TYPE: Heavyweight submarine-launched wire-guided acoustic homing torpedo

FUNCTION: Launched from 19‑inch submarine tubes (with 21‑inch guide rails), the NT‑37C begins with a straight run then receives mid-course steering via wire link. In terminal phase it deploys passive/active sonar homing at ranges of ~0.6 km to intercept deep or fast submarine targets.

IOC: Circa 1973–1975
Manufacturer: Northrop Corporation (later Honeywell) / Naval Ordnance Station Forest Park, USA
Operators: United States; Netherlands; Israel; other NATO allies 
Platforms: Submarines equipped with 19‑inch tubes (U.S. and allied SSNs/SSKs)
